MTD provider provides mtd_info object to mtd subsystem. With kref patch the mtd_info object can be alive after provider released mtd device. Fix calling order in _get and _put functions to allow mtd provider to safely alloc and release mtd object. Execute: 1) call external _get 2) get_module 3) add internal kref in the get function and opposite order in the put one. The _put_device callback should be the last in put as the master struct memory may be freed in this callback.
